ممکن است برای شما مفید باشد که گاهی محتوای یک سلول را در پاورقی یک کاربرگ قرار دهید و هر بار که محتوای سلول تغییر می کند، پاورقی به روز شود. ساده ترین راه برای انجام این کار با ماکرو است. در زیر نمونه ای از ماکرو است که محتویات سلول A1 را در سمت چپ پاورقی قرار می دهد:
Private Sub Worksheet_Change(ByVal Target As Excel.Range)
ActiveSheet.PageSetup.LeftFooter = Range("A1").Text
End Sub
ماکرو هر بار که اکسل محاسبه مجدد عادی خود را انجام می دهد، اجرا می شود - یعنی هر بار که محتوای هر سلول تغییر می کند یا کسی F9 را فشار می دهد. اگر میخواهید محتوا در قسمت دیگری از فوتر باشد، میتوانید LeftFooter را به CenterFooter یا RightFooter تغییر دهید.
برای اعمال هر قالب بندی به پاورقی به غیر از حالت پیش فرض، باید کدهای قالب بندی خاصی را اضافه کنید، و همچنین می توانید از کدهای داده ویژه ای استفاده کنید که اکسل برای سرصفحه ها و پاورقی ها تشخیص می دهد. هر دو قالب بندی ویژه و کدهای داده خاص بسیار طولانی هستند و در شماره های دیگر ExcelTips پوشش داده شده اند.
اگر با یک کاربرگ بسیار بزرگ کار میکنید، تغییر پاورقی هر بار که اکسل مجدداً محاسبه میکند ممکن است باعث کندی غیرضروری رایانه شما شود. پس از همه، پاورقی برای کاربر نامرئی می ماند تا زمانی که کاربرگ واقعاً چاپ شود. در این مورد، شما فقط باید نام ماکرو فوق را به نام دیگری تغییر دهید که سپس به صورت دستی به عنوان آخرین مرحله قبل از چاپ یک کاربرگ اجرا می کنید.